As a Talent Acquisition Compliance Specialist on the Operations and Innovation team you will focus on TA Compliance reporting to the TA Compliance Lead. This position will be responsible for all facets in compliance with internal hiring guidelines pre-employment requirements such as background checks and external regulations set by EEOC and OFCCP.
Key Responsibilities
- Responsible for maintaining Offer Compliance including adherence to compensation guidelines and documentation including Letters and Employee Agreements for pre employment compliance
- Serve as Talent Acquisitions subject matter expert in the offer preparation process including working closely with Total Rewards Recruiters and Candidates
- Serve as Talent Acquisitions subject matter expert in the background check process including working closely with TA Coordinators Recruiters Candidates and internal stakeholders
- Maintains accuracy of Total Rewards for TA trainings and documentation of policies and procedures
- Maintains accuracy of background check and drug test process in talent acquisition workflow
- Acts as the point person for any background check escalations that may result in working with the candidate or key stakeholders
- Works with Global Security Legal EHS Fleet EWR Recruiter and Candidate depending on type of escalation (MVR Social Media Criminal History Falsification of Records)
- Create and facilitate background check training sessions for new Talent Acquisition Coordinators
- Maintains Hire Eligibility in coordination with Employee Workplace Relations
- Responsible for identification and collection of documents for review and production in compliance with the US Transparency Team
- May assist in preparation and documentation for the AbbVie Immigration Matters Program
- Assist with responses and questionnaires from HR Operations Legal and/or Compliance
- Ensure compliance to state/federal employment laws and AbbVie policies and practices for applicant tracking compliance and reporting metrics
Qualifications :
Qualifications
- Bachelors degree required
- Minimum 2 years experience in a Talent Acquisition or compliance function
- Must be comfortable using discretion independent judgment and critical thinking skills for maintaining compliance
- High attention to detail and maintaining process
- Comfortable working in a high-volume role requiring significant multi-tasking
- Strong business presence and communication skills
- Strong organizational skills and attention to detail while meeting deadlines
